Are you ready for Masters Of Illusion Season 10?

PAX TV launched an amazing TV show named ‘Masters Of Illusion’ in 2000. The show was a huge success. Then it moved to MyNetwork TV in 2009. The TV telecasted four specials. Again in 2014, The CW renewed the show for many seasons with new and exciting episodes. Dean Cain is the host of the show. The show is shot in their studio at Hollywood, California. It features a lot of magicians/illusionists in every season. It also highlights new and bright performers.

Who are the makers?

The producing company is Associated Television International. The executive producers are David Mc Kenzie, Gay Blackstone, David Martin, Al-Schwartz. ‘Masters of Illusion’ is also co-executively produced by Jim Romanovich.
The CW said in a press release recently, “Masters of Illusion returns for more magical surprises on Friday, May 15 [8.00 pm – 8.30 pm] with back to back original episodes on premiere night”.
